我想知道我们可以一次发送给用户的苹果推送通知数量是否有限制? 换句话说,我可以使用APNS服务一次发送100,000个推送通知吗?
答案 0 :(得分:15)
如果您在短时间内向同一设备发送多个通知,推送服务将仅发送最后一个。
在该文档中查看“收到的一些通知,但不是全部通知”。
答案 1 :(得分:9)
Apple's Tech Note最近更新以解决此问题:
使用APN没有上限或批量大小限制。 iOS 6.1 新闻稿称,APN已经发送超过4万亿次推送 自成立以来的通知。它是在2012年WWDC上宣布的 APN每天发送70亿条通知。
如果您发现吞吐量低于每秒9,000次通知, 您的服务器可能会受益于改进的错误处理逻辑。
答案 2 :(得分:5)
您可以发送给Apple APNS服务器的通知数量没有限制,但提醒您避免使用分配连接,因为如果Apple认为您正在进行DDOS攻击,Apple可能会禁用您的IP。
此外,如果用户离线(iPhone无信号),只有最新的推送通知将保存在苹果的APNS服务器中
答案 3 :(得分:2)
是的,你可以!您最多也可以使用20个连接来发送数据。